Men’s Basketball: Cadets Fall Short Versus Saint Joseph’s (ME), 79-65
NORTHFIELD, Vt. – Despite a game-high 30 points from senior forward Antonio Davis (Albany, N.Y.), the Norwich University men’s basketball team could not get past visiting Saint Joseph’s College, falling 79-65 Feb. 7 at Andrews Hall. The loss dropped the Cadets to 5-16 overall and 4-11 in Great Northeast Athletic Conference (GNAC) play.
Davis shot lights out from both the floor and the free-throw line, hitting on 10-of-13 attempts from the field and 10-of-11 chances from the charity stripe. The fourth-year player also had game-highs in rebounds (eight) and blocks (three).
The Monks were led by Chris Petzy’s 22 points which included a five-of-seven performance from beyond the three-point arc. Teammates Zach O’Brien and Matthew Medeiros also contributed double figures for SJC, scoring 17 and 14 points respectively.
Freshman forward Evan Tullar (Chelsea, Vt.) and junior guard Josh Cabrera (Providence, R.I.) each pitched in nine points for the Cadets. Sophomore guard Nickolai Havoutis (Coral Gables, Fla.) dished out a team-high five assists for NU.
Norwich takes to the road Saturday, Feb. 11, to take on GNAC-foe Emmanuel at 1 p.m. The Cadets lost in their first matchup with the Saints this season, a 64-41 decision at home on Dec. 10.
